Uruguay is in no urgent need for internationally financing its loan deficits, said Central Bank President Mario Bergara.
Uruguay's deficit has been reviewed and adjusted to two percent of the gross domestic product, up from the previous forecast of one percent. The government has already said that it has locked in a number of loans to pre-finance this deficit, saying that it will always analyze when the right moment is when it comes to international financing.
